# Ledgerlens Environments

Quick orientation before you review the audit-log viewer PR. Ledgerlens runs in three environments: sandbox (wide open, fake data from the Fabulator seeder), staging (mirrors prod schema, scrubbed events), and prod (read-only UI, no mutations ever). The viewer talks to the event store through the Chronicle gateway, so pagination quirks you see locally usually vanish in staging. For reference while reviewing, staging currently runs with these configuration values.

settings of tagef-bawif:
DRUIX_HOST=druix.zemvarlabs.internal
DRUIX_PORT=8000

**Ticket: Trace config drift on Larkspan mesh**

Heads up for the security review — the request tracing setup across our Larkspan microservices has drifted again. The orders and inventory services are sampling at different rates, and the span propagation headers don't match what staging expects. Nothing scary yet, but it makes auditing cross-service calls painful. Dex from the platform crew confirmed the drift started after last month's rollout. For reference during your review, here are the current values as pulled from production.

service settings:
PRAIX_LOG_LEVEL=error
PRAIX_METRICS_HOST=metrics.praix.qorvelcorp.corp
PRAIX_POOL_SIZE=16

**Vendor note: Inkmill markdown pipeline**

Rendering for Parchway docs is outsourced to Inkmill under an annual contract, renewing each March. They handle sanitization and PDF export; we own the upload queue. SLA: 4-hour response on rendering failures. Escalate only after two failed retries. Their support desk is reachable at the address below.

billing contact of hahaf-baguf = zorael.tammir.jorius@sivrelhq.internal